2008/6/5 Benjamin Webb <address@hidden>:
>
> AFAICT, the amount of non-free software on the ubuntu cds is really
> quite small, and distributing it is a necessary evil in order to get
> some people interesting in software freedom.
It used to be when there was no alternative. Now there is gNewSense,
there is no excuse.
>> promoting one of the distributions that aims to be fully free software
>> would be a good extra option.
>
> Yes, we should always have gnewsense cds as well, and explain that
> they are more free than ubuntu. However, I don't think it is practical
> to give gnewsense cds to most first-time-gnu-users, as most will see
> even switiching to ubuntu as an inconvenience.
I don't think it is principled for a free software group to give
proprietary software to people. Most will follow that action to its
conclusion - never wanting to switch to a 100% free system. Like
almost all GNU/Linux users, who don't know why the system they love to
use exists.
Let the open source LUGs do that; what else differentiates FS groups
from LUGs if not standing firm on the principle of software freedom?
